Korean Air Cargo Ranks No. 1 Among IATA Scheduled Carriers

Credit: KOREAN AIR
Asian carriers account for four of the top six slots among scheduled airlines in the 2005 air cargo results accumulated by the International Air Transport Assn. As usual, Memphis, Tenn.-based Federal Express tops the list as the world's biggest cargo airline. But for the second year, Korean Air...
